studentsDepending on your school or college you may be placed on work experience for 1 or 2 weeks, in some cases you may be placed for 1 or 2 days per week for a longer period of time. For most of you this will be your first experience of a working environment and many situations will be new and strange to you. It is crucial to your development that this first experience of work is a positive learning situation.The outcomes of work experience can be many and varied but we would expect all in placements you will develop social skills and work specific skills.
